Hurkacz’s rival has posted a post and is receiving threats from the Russians. “Much scarier”

On Friday at 14:00 Hubert Hurkacz will play with Andrei Rublev in the semi-finals of the ATP 500 tennis tournament in Dubai. However, the Polish rival’s thoughts are not about the match, but about what is happening in Ukraine due to Russian aggression.

After Russia’s attack on Ukraine on Thursday morning, Rublev posted graphics of two characters in the colors of both countries on social media. Graphics where these characters hug each other. “Ukraine and Russia are closely related to each other, we are fraternal nations” – we read under what he posted on the Rublev network.

Rublev under attack on the web

In an interview with journalists in Dubai, the Russian told the difficult situation he found himself in. – At such moments you realize that your match is not important. What is happening is much more terrible. You realize the importance of world peace and mutual respect no matter what. It is about taking care of our earth and each other. This is the most important – said Rublow, quoted by the portal france24.com.

The Russian added that due to his activity in the subject, he received offensive messages from his countrymen. – Of course I get aggressive comments on the internet because I am Russian. Even if they throw stones at me, I have to show that I am for peace, I am not here to be aggressive, even if I am not responsible for something – said Rublev.

The Russian is currently the 7th ATP tennis player. Rublev is the Olympic champion from Tokyo in mixed game. The tennis player won the tournament in tandem with his compatriot – Anastasia Pavlyuchenkova.
